The image displays an informational card from a museum exhibit titled "COSTUMES" on "LEVEL 6." The card details various historical costumes and accessories, primarily from the 19th and early 20th centuries, likely part of a cultural or ethnographic collection. The exhibit features several garments on mannequins or stands, including jackets (Capetana), chemises (Pukamis), coats (Anteri), waistcoats (Yelek), robes (caftans), and baggy trousers (Shalvar). Smaller items, such as jewelry (earrings, belts, chains, pendants, charms, chatelaines), a gold pocket watch, and amulet cases, are visible in display cases below the garments. The items are often described with their material (silk, velvet, linen), specific embroidery details, and geographic origins like Constantinople (Istanbul), Rhodes, Ioannina, Chalkis, and Central Europe. Notable details from the text include descriptions of a "Romaniote wedding costume" from Ioannina, children's clothing items and accessories, and specific mentions of donors for each artifact. The card itself, partially visible in a hand, includes the instruction "PLEASE, RETURN THIS CARD TO ITS PLACE, AS A COURTE," indicating it is an interpretive guide for visitors. The context of Athens, Greece, suggests these items are part of a collection displayed in a museum in that city.
